The Cloverdale Historical Society operates the Cloverdale Museum of History, preserving the cultural heritage of northern Sonoma County. Located on North Cloverdale Boulevard, the museum displays regional artifacts, historical photographs, local Pomo basketry, and early pioneer exhibits. Visitors can explore indoor history displays alongside a garden and historic house area.
History
Founded in the early 2000s, the Cloverdale Historical Society has played a pivotal role in collecting and preserving the local history of Cloverdale. It offers a glimpse into the past through its various programs and events, engaging locals and visitors alike.
